What affects the price

When you call for electrical help, a few things influence the final bill. The biggest factor is the scope of the project—swapping out a basic outlet is a quick task, while rewiring a room or upgrading an old panel requires much more labor and time. The age of your home also plays a role, as older wiring often needs extra care to meet current safety standards. Parts and material quality also change the total cost. About this service

A circuit is the complete path that electricity travels from the power source to your appliances and back again. When a circuit fails, you might notice lights flickering or outlets losing power. You need an expert if you are constantly tripping breakers, which suggests the circuit is overloaded or has a faulty connection. Costs vary based on the amount of wiring needed and wall access. Are copper electrical wiring systems still the standard for new installations in Joliet?

Yes, copper electrical wiring remains the industry standard for new residential and commercial installations throughout Joliet. Copper offers superior conductivity and durability compared to older aluminum wiring systems, making it the preferred material for most circuits. The pros ensure all copper wiring is installed to meet current NEC standards, including proper gauge selection for the intended load. When might I need an electrical box extender in Joliet?

An electrical box extender is typically needed in Joliet when you're installing a thicker wall finish, such as paneling or shiplap, over an existing electrical box. This ensures the device (like an outlet or switch) sits flush with the new surface, maintaining code compliance and a professional appearance. The pros can assess if an extender is necessary during your renovation or update project. It's a small but crucial component for a finished look and safe operation.

What factors influence the cost of electrical wire for a project in Joliet?

The cost of electrical wire in Joliet is primarily influenced by the type of wire (e.g., THHN, NM-B), its gauge (thickness), and the quantity required for the project. Specialty wires, like those for high-voltage applications or specific environmental conditions, will also affect pricing. The pros will determine the appropriate wire specifications based on your electrical system's demands and current building codes.
